Judy Brown

Analyst, ADL

Judy Brown has been involved in technology for learning for over 25 years, and with mobile learning since 1996. She retired in 2006 as the Emerging Technology Analyst in the Office of Learning and Information Technology at the University of Wisconsin System. In early 2000, she founded and was Executive Director at the UW System of the Academic ADL Co-Lab with the U.S. Department of Defense. She now works entirely in the mobile learning area with government, corporations, and schools. Currently back with the ADL, Judy works on the ADL Immersive Learning Technologies Team leading mobile learning, on the Army Education Advisory Committee, and she coordinates the mlearnopedia.com and cc.mlearnopedia.com sites.
